    In this episode of Continuous Delivery Office Hours, Tony, Bob, and Steve tackle the controversial headline “DevOps is dead” and unpack our industry’s bizarre obsession with killing off its own concepts.

    We seem to suffer from a collective amnesia every six to twelve months, leading us to abandon powerful ideas as soon as they get hard or misunderstood. If we treat DevOps as a bloated “ivory tower” process or reduce it to a simple checklist, we miss the point entirely. The name itself may be heavily polluted, but the core practices of collaboration, breaking down silos, and delivering safely are far from obsolete.

    Declaring DevOps dead is often just an escape hatch for simpler checklists, like treating Platform Engineering as an easy shortcut rather than doing the hard cultural work. Ultimately, whether we call it DevOps, Platform Engineering, or something else, we still have to deliver high-quality software safely.
